Cyient DLM Q1 Results: Cyient DLM announced announced its April-June quarter results for fiscal 2025-26 (Q1FY26) on Tuesday, July 22, reporting a drop of 29.6% in its consolidated net profit to Rs 7.5 crore, compared to Rs 10.6 crore in the corresponding period last year.
The tech company focused on design led manufacturing reported a rise of 18% in its topline (revenue from operations) to Rs 278 crore in the first quarter of current fiscal, compared to Rs 258 crore in the year-ago period.

Cyient DLM Q1 FY26 Highlights (Consolidated, YoY)
Revenue up 8% to Rs 278 crore versus Rs 258 crore (Estimate: Rs 290 crore
EBITDA up 25.3% to Rs 25 crore versus Rs 20 crore (Estimate: Rs 22 crore)
Margin at 9% versus 7.8% (Estimate: 7.5%)
Net profit down 29.6% to Rs 7.5 crore versus Rs 10.6 crore (Estimate: Rs 8 crore)

Cyient DLM Q1 Performance
Cyient DLM attributed the profit drop to a less favourable revenue mix and higher input costs during the quarter. However, the company maintained a positive outlook for the rest of the year, highlighting a strong order book and pipeline opportunities. It said that the revenue growth impacted by completion of large order in FY25 offset by addition of revenue from M&A.
The net profit was impacted by amortization of intangibles which is a noncash item and reduced interest income due to IPO proceeds utilization. The material cost ratio improved due to better mix and improved supply chain efforts.
Also, material cost is lower in US operations. The employee cost and other expense increase on an annual basis was due to the inclusion of US operations. Shares of Cyient DLM settled 1.33% higher at Rs 481.20 apiece on the BSE.
